    Types of Job Roles Available

    Exploring JP Morgan job openings in Singapore reveals a wide range of roles across various departments. Understanding the different types of positions available can help you target your job search and tailor your application to the specific requirements of each role. JP Morgan's operations in Singapore span numerous areas, including investment banking, asset management, technology, operations, and corporate functions. Each of these areas offers unique career opportunities for individuals with diverse skill sets and experience levels. In investment banking, roles typically involve advising companies on mergers and acquisitions, underwriting securities offerings, and providing strategic financial advice. These positions require strong analytical skills, financial acumen, and the ability to work under pressure. Asset management roles focus on managing investment portfolios for individuals and institutions. This involves conducting market research, analyzing investment opportunities, and making investment decisions to achieve clients' financial goals. Technology roles are critical to JP Morgan's operations, as the company relies heavily on technology to support its business activities. These roles include software development, data analysis, cybersecurity, and IT infrastructure management. Operations roles involve supporting the day-to-day operations of the company, such as processing transactions, managing risk, and ensuring compliance with regulatory requirements. These positions require strong attention to detail, problem-solving skills, and the ability to work effectively in a team environment. Corporate functions roles include areas such as human resources, finance, marketing, and legal. These roles support the overall operations of the company and require a diverse range of skills and expertise. Within each of these departments, there are various levels of positions, ranging from entry-level roles to senior management positions. Entry-level roles are typically designed for recent graduates or individuals with limited experience, while senior management positions require extensive experience and leadership skills.     How to Apply and What They Look For

    When pursuing JP Morgan job openings in Singapore, understanding the application process and what the company looks for in candidates is crucial. Knowing these aspects can significantly increase your chances of success. The application process at JP Morgan typically begins with an online application. You'll need to create an account on the JP Morgan careers website and search for open positions in Singapore. Be sure to carefully review the job descriptions and requirements for each role before applying. Once you've found a position that matches your skills and experience, you can submit your application online. This typically involves uploading your resume and cover letter, as well as completing an online questionnaire. Your resume and cover letter are your first opportunity to make a strong impression. Be sure to highlight your relevant skills, experience, and accomplishments. Tailor your resume and cover letter to the specific requirements of the job you're applying for. Use keywords from the job description to demonstrate that you have the skills and experience they're looking for. After submitting your application, it will be reviewed by the JP Morgan recruiting team. If your application is selected for further consideration, you may be invited to participate in a phone or video interview. This is your opportunity to showcase your communication skills, personality, and enthusiasm for the role. If you pass the initial screening, you may be invited to participate in one or more in-person interviews. These interviews may be conducted by hiring managers, team members, and HR representatives. Be prepared to answer questions about your skills, experience, and career goals. JP Morgan is looking for candidates who are intelligent, motivated, and passionate about their work. They want individuals who are team players, problem solvers, and effective communicators. They also value diversity and inclusion and seek candidates from a variety of backgrounds and experiences. In addition to your skills and experience, JP Morgan also looks for candidates who align with their company values. These values include integrity, respect, and excellence. Be sure to demonstrate these values throughout the application and interview process.     Tips for Acing the Interview

    To successfully navigate JP Morgan job openings in Singapore, acing the interview is paramount. A well-prepared and confident candidate can significantly increase their chances of securing a position. The interview process at JP Morgan is designed to assess not only your skills and experience but also your personality, cultural fit, and overall potential. One of the most important tips for acing the interview is to thoroughly research JP Morgan and the specific role you're applying for. Understand the company's mission, values, and recent news. This will help you demonstrate your interest in the company and your understanding of its business. Prepare for common interview questions, such as "Tell me about yourself," "Why do you want to work at JP Morgan?" and "What are your strengths and weaknesses?" Practice your answers out loud so that you can deliver them confidently and concisely. Use the STAR method (Situation, Task, Action, Result) to structure your answers and provide specific examples of your accomplishments. Be prepared to discuss your skills and experience in detail. Highlight your relevant skills and provide examples of how you've used them to achieve results. Be honest and transparent about your skills and experience. Don't exaggerate or misrepresent your abilities. Ask thoughtful questions at the end of the interview. This shows that you're engaged and interested in the role and the company. Prepare a list of questions in advance, but also be prepared to ask follow-up questions based on the conversation. Dress professionally and arrive on time for the interview. First impressions matter, so make sure you look and act the part. Be polite and respectful to everyone you encounter, from the receptionist to the hiring manager. During the interview, be yourself and let your personality shine through. Be enthusiastic, positive, and genuine. The interviewer wants to get to know you as a person, so don't be afraid to show your true colors. After the interview, send a thank-you note to the interviewer within 24 hours. This shows your appreciation for their time and reinforces your interest in the role.     Networking: Your Secret Weapon

    When targeting JP Morgan job openings in Singapore, don't underestimate the power of networking. Networking can be your secret weapon in uncovering opportunities and gaining a competitive edge. Building connections within the industry and at JP Morgan can open doors that might otherwise remain closed. Networking involves building relationships with people who can provide you with information, advice, and support in your job search. This can include friends, family members, former colleagues, industry professionals, and JP Morgan employees. Start by reaching out to your existing network and letting them know that you're interested in working at JP Morgan in Singapore. Ask if they know anyone who works at the company or in the industry. Attend industry events and career fairs to meet new people and expand your network. These events provide opportunities to connect with JP Morgan employees and learn about the company's culture and opportunities. Use LinkedIn to connect with JP Morgan employees and industry professionals. Send personalized connection requests and participate in relevant groups and discussions. Informational interviews are a valuable networking tool. Reach out to JP Morgan employees and request a brief informational interview to learn about their experiences and gain insights into the company. Prepare a list of questions in advance and be respectful of their time. When networking, focus on building genuine relationships rather than simply asking for a job. Show interest in the other person's work and offer to help them in any way you can. Be patient and persistent. Networking takes time and effort, but it can pay off in the long run. Don't get discouraged if you don't see immediate results. Stay connected with your network and continue to build relationships. Remember, networking is a two-way street. Offer to help others in your network and be a valuable resource to them.
